Bewsey Knitting Club

Primary Knitters keeping our neonatal babies warm!

Bewsey Lodge Primary School presented the neonatal unit at Warrington Hospital with their latest pieces from their after school knitting club.

The knitting club has been keeping the Trust’s babies warm and snug for several years now and never fail to amaze us with their skills.

The group are avid knitters who made blankets, cardigans and hats for the little babies on the unit.

Julia Austin, the nursery nurse on the unit went to the school to meet them and collect the knitwear commented,

“It is always lovely when we receive donations to the unit, but it is extra special when it is made by children. I really enjoyed visiting the school and seeing the children in action, they made me feel very welcome.”
